ApplicationBase.GetEnvironmentVariable(String) Metodo

Definizione

Restituisce il valore della variabile di ambiente specificata.

public:
 System::String ^ GetEnvironmentVariable(System::String ^ name);
public string GetEnvironmentVariable (string name);
member this.GetEnvironmentVariable : string -> string
Public Function GetEnvironmentVariable (name As String) As String

Parametri

name
String

String contenente il nome della variabile di ambiente.

Restituisce

String contenente il valore della variabile di ambiente con il nome name.

Eccezioni

name è Nothing.

La variabile di ambiente specificata da name non esiste.

Il codice chiamante non dispone di autorizzazione EnvironmentPermission con accesso Read.

Esempio

In questo esempio viene utilizzato il My.Application.GetEnvironmentVariable metodo per ottenere e visualizzare il valore della variabile di ambiente PATH, se disponibile. In caso contrario, viene visualizzato un messaggio che indica che la variabile di ambiente PATH non esiste.

Private Sub TestGetEnvironmentVariable()
    Try
        MsgBox("PATH = " & My.Application.GetEnvironmentVariable("PATH"))
    Catch ex As System.ArgumentException
        MsgBox("Environment variable 'PATH' does not exist.")
    End Try
End Sub

Commenti

Il My.Application.GetEnvironmentVariable metodo restituisce la variabile di ambiente con il nome name. Questo metodo è simile a Environment.GetEnvironmentVariable(String), ad eccezione del fatto che questo metodo genera un'eccezione se la variabile di ambiente specificata da name non esiste.

Disponibilità per tipo di progetto

Tipo di progetto Disponibile
Windows Forms Application
Libreria di classi
Applicazione console
Libreria di controllo Windows Form
Libreria di controlli Web No
Servizio Windows
Sito Web No

Si applica a

Vedi anche